Loved staying here. The huts are quite small so our bags were a bit crowded, and the hot water didn't work at first so we had someone come and look and fixed it, it was still a bit of a balancing act to get it between boiling and cold. Besides that and all the stairs, it was lovely, i loved not having a TV too. The hotel is a bit tricky to get to, so if you're offered transfers, definitely take them! i don't have a clue how we would've got there with suitcases. The pool is lovely, and a private beach is right on your door step. It's also a short walk to lots of good restaurants. If you rent scooters off the hotel, i suggest getting them to get you up the hill first, as it's almost impossible to navigate on your own if you're a novice rider.

We stayed at 10 hotels in a span of 3 weeks. Out of all our hotels, we liked this one the least--mostly because of the location. Please know, this hotel was quite fine--we just picked a lot of great hotels to stay at. Although the hotel was walking distance to a few restaurants, it was a lot of cliff-like steps to climb. Also, getting our luggage from the truck to our room was quite and experience. Even though we had more luggage than a normal backpacker, we were not expecting to have to maneuver down a steep hill with the fear of slipping. We did see a sign that said "Where Cliff meets the Beach"...they are kidding. Hah! The food and pool were both very good. The wifi was the worst we encountered all trip. With it being hard to get around the island, no tv, and limited activities, wifi was of importance to us.
